The Fund’s objective is to outperform the MSCI India Net Return (AUD) benchmark on a net of fees basis, with a focus on capital growth and downside protection. Dr Mary Manning and her team aim to generate positive returns and minimise negative returns by investing in companies in which they have the highest conviction. They filter the investment universe repeatedly to identify those companies that are likely to offer the best risk/reward profile, then assess them in detail through disciplined, ‘bottom up’ fundamental analysis and overlay that with their identified structural themes driving growth in India in order to construct the portfolio.

Mary is a member of the investment team and is a Portfolio Manager for the Ellerston Asia Growth Fund, Ellerston Asian Investments (ASX:EAI) and the Ellerston India Fund. Mary has over 20 years investment management expertise and joined Ellerston in 2012. Mary first worked in Asia in 1997 and has been investing in the region since 2001. Prior to joining Ellerston Capital, Mary worked at Oaktree Capital in New York and Singapore. In Singapore, she was the sole person responsible for financial sector investments for the firm’s Global Emerging Markets Hedge Fund.
Mary also worked as an investment analyst at Soros Fund Management in New York, the investment vehicle of George Soros. She focused on investments in the financial sector in the US, Asia, including Japan and Europe.
Mary has a PhD in Economics from the University of Sydney, an MBA from Harvard Business School and a Bachelor of Commerce degree from the University Of Calgary, Canada.
